The workshop was organized against the background of the recent developments in the Zambian economy such as the structural adjustment programmes, public service reforms including retrenchment, skill shortages, the inability to create sufficient newjobs each year to
keep up with the growth in the labour force, the brain drain,unemployment and underemployment and the demand to meet the emerging challenges of sustainable human development in Zambia.
